The goal of the Global Action Plan is to contribute to greater food security, reduced food price volatility, and higher incomes and greater well-being for rural populations through evidence-based policies in line with the first Millennium Development Goal: “Eradicate extreme poverty and hunger.” In addition, improved policies will contribute to the sustainable use of land and water resources and the adaptation of agricultural activities to climate change to meet the challenges of MDG 7: “Ensure environmental sustainability.” The Global Action Plan provides the framework needed to rebuild a sustainable national statistical capacity to produce agricultural statistics and increase their use for better policy decisions. It also supports implementation of the methodology required to produce statistics to meet emerging data requirements and help restore the international support system for agricultural statistics. The plan is centred on the three pillars of the Global Strategy: (1) establish a minimum set of core data; (2) integrate agriculture into the national statistical system; and (3) foster sustainability of the statistical system through governance and statistical capacity building. The Action Plan includes a big research Plan, whose goal is to develop and disseminate advanced and cost-effective methodologies, tools, and standards for the use of agricultural statisticians in developing countries. These will be in the form of methodological publications which will be the basis for guidelines, handbooks, and documentation of good practices in priority research topics to foster the production of reliable statistics. The Outcome of the Action Plan is to enable target countries to develop sustainable statistical systems for production and dissemination of accurate and timely agricultural and rural statistics, comparable over time and across countries. In order to achieve this outcome, four global outputs are identified as follow: 1. Effective governing bodies set up and functioning at global and regional levels; 2. Coordinating bodies of the national statistical system, legal frameworks and strategic plans established (by the countries) in the target countries, to enable the integration of agriculture into the national statistical system; 3. New cost effective methods for data collection, analysis and dissemination developed and disseminated; 4. Increased capacity of agricultural statistics staff in regional training centres (i.e. trainers) and target countries.
